가격 분석
Average pricing is trending upward modestly because of energy costs, high-performance specifications, and growing demand for low-carbon and recycled materials. However, pricing remains competitive in standard-grade aluminum and engineering plastics where scale and substitution pressure are strong.
| 비용 구성 요소 | 점유율 (%) |
|---|---|
| Raw materials | 44% |
| Processing and conversion | 22% |
| Energy and utilities | 12% |
| Labor and quality control | 10% |
| 물류 및 규정 준수 | 12% |
Typical gross margins range from 14% to 26%, with higher margins in aerospace-grade composites, specialty alloys, and application-specific engineered materials. Commodity-grade products generally sit at the lower end of the range, while customized and certified materials earn stronger pricing power.
제조 및 생산 분석
A mid-scale lightweight materials production and conversion facility typically requires USD 45–120 million, depending on the material mix, processing technology, and certification requirements. Composite and aerospace-grade operations need higher investment than standard metal forming plants.
Key Machinery & Equipment
- Melting and casting systems
- Rolling mills and extrusion lines
- Autoclaves and curing ovens
- Injection and compression molding machines
- 절단, 다듬기, 마무리 장비
- Non-destructive testing and quality inspection systems
Manufacturing Process Flow
- Raw material procurement and verification
- Melting, blending, or resin preparation
- Forming, molding, or layup operations
- Heat treatment, curing, or finishing
- Inspection, testing, and certification
- 포장 및 유통

시장 역학
Drivers
- Automotive and aerospace manufacturers are increasing use of lightweight materials to improve energy efficiency and extend range.
- Electrification of vehicles is driving demand for weight reduction to offset battery mass.
- Construction and infrastructure projects are adopting lighter materials to improve installation speed and structural efficiency.
- Sustainability targets are encouraging lower-emission material choices and recycling-oriented supply chains.
Restraints
- High production costs limit adoption in price-sensitive end markets.
- Processing complexity can increase scrap rates and manufacturing challenges.
- Volatile raw material prices affect margins and contract stability.
- Performance certification requirements slow adoption in safety-critical applications.
Opportunities
- Growth in electric vehicles creates demand for lightweight structural and thermal management materials.
- Recycled aluminum and bio-based polymers offer attractive sustainability-led product opportunities.
- Aircraft retrofit and next-generation mobility programs support premium material demand.
- Industrial automation and robotics can improve material processing efficiency and quality consistency.
Challenges
- Balancing cost reduction with mechanical performance remains difficult.
- Supply chain concentration in certain alloys and fibers can create procurement risk.
- Design engineers often require long validation cycles before switching material systems.
- Regional differences in standards and recycling rules complicate commercial rollout.
